Do Indians Need an Armenia Visa?
Yes, Indian citizens need a visa to enter Armenia. Indians are eligible for an electronic visa that can be applied for online through the official website. The types of Armenian visas for Indians include:
|
Visa Name |
Entry Type |
Stay Duration |
Validity |
Govt Fees |
Processing Time |
Form |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
|
Visitor Visa |
Single |
21 days |
3 months |
USD 6/ INR 516 |
3 business days |
EVisa |
|
Long Term Visa |
Single |
120 days |
6 months |
USD 30/ INR 2,582 |
3 business days |
EVisa |
Armenia Visa Eligibility Criteria For Indians
To be eligible for an Armenia visa, Indian applicants must meet these criteria:
-
Valid Passport:
-
Your Indian passport must have at least 6 months’ validity from the planned entry date into Armenia.
-
It should have at least one blank page for visa stamps.
-
-
Purpose of Visit: You must clearly state your reason for traveling to Armenia, including tourism, business, or visiting family/friends.
-
Proof of Funds: You must show sufficient financial means to cover your expenses during the stay.
-
Accommodation Details: Provide confirmed hotel bookings or an invitation letter from a host in Armenia.
-
Return/Onward Journey: You must have a confirmed return ticket to India or an onward journey ticket from Armenia.

Armenia Visa Fees For Indians
The Armenia visa fees for Indians vary based on the type and duration of the visa:
|
Type of Visa |
Visa Duration |
Govt Fees |
OneVasco Fees |
|---|---|---|---|
|
Visitor Visa |
21 days |
USD 6/ INR 516 |
USD 12/ INR 1033 |
|
Long Term Visitor Visa |
120 days |
USD 30/ INR 2,582 |
USD 12/ INR 1033 |
-
Visa Fee Payment: The Armenia visa fees for Indians must be paid online via credit card during the e-visa application process.
-
Non-Refundable Fee: The visa fee is non-refundable, even if your application is rejected or you decide not to travel.

Armenia Visa Requirements & Documents for Indians
Visa Application Form
-
Complete the online Armenia e-Visa application form with accurate personal, passport, and travel details.
-
Provide a valid email address to receive your e-visa and notifications.
-
Upload a recent passport-style digital photograph as per the specifications.
Personal Documents
-
Passport:
-
Scanned copy of your Indian passport’s biodata page.
-
Ensure your passport has at least 6 months’ validity and one blank page.
-
-
Photograph:
-
A recent passport-size color photograph with a white background.
-
The photo should be clear, with your face fully visible.
-
-
Travel Itinerary:
-
Confirmed flight tickets to and from Armenia.
-
Proof of accommodation, such as hotel bookings or an invitation letter.
-
-
Proof of Funds:
-
Bank statements for the past 6 months show sufficient funds.
-
Income tax returns or payslips may also be required.
-
-
Cover letter:
For families and groups, a single cover letter must be submitted, along with the list of group members.
Armenia Visa Process for Indians
Follow these steps to apply for your Armenia visa from India:
-
Fill out the Armenian visa application form from the official Ministry of Foreign Affairs website.
-
Upload the required documents:
-
A valid passport (minimum 6 months validity)
-
One recent passport-size photo
-
A completed visa application form
-
A cover letter stating your travel purpose
-
Round-trip flight tickets
-
A hotel booking or accommodation proof
-
Travel insurance,
-
Proof of financial means (bank statement or salary slips)
-
Any supporting documents, like an invitation letter, if applicable.
-
-
Pay the visa fee, usually paid in INR as per current exchange rates.
-
Wait for the visa to be processed, which usually takes 3 working days.
-
Once approved, your evisa will be sent to you at your registered email.
-
If your visa is denied, you can reach out to the Embassy to resolve the issue.

Armenia Stay Duration, Validity, and Extension for Indians
Here’s a quick overview of the stay duration, validity, and extension options for an Armenia visa for Indians:
|
Visa |
Stay Duration |
Validity |
Extension |
|---|---|---|---|
|
Visitor Visa (Single Entry) |
21 days |
3 months |
Not extendable |
|
Long Term Visitor Visa (Single Entry) |
120 days |
6 months |
Not extendable |

Top Reasons to Visit Armenia for Indians
Climate and Top Season
Armenia has a continental climate with long, hot summers and short, cold winters. The best time to visit is from May to October, when the weather is pleasant for outdoor activities. June to August is the peak tourist season.
Culture
Armenia boasts a rich cultural heritage dating back to ancient times. It was the first nation to adopt Christianity as its official religion in 301 AD. The country is dotted with medieval monasteries, churches, and fortresses that showcase its unique history and architecture.
Attractions
-
Yerevan: The capital city is known for its vibrant cafe culture, museums, and the iconic Republic Square.
-
Lake Sevan: This stunning high-altitude lake is a popular spot for swimming, boating, and picnics.
-
Geghard Monastery: A UNESCO World Heritage Site, this 4th-century monastery is partially carved out of a mountain.
-
Garni Temple: The only pagan temple in Armenia, dating back to the 1st century AD.
-
Tatev Monastery: Accessible by the world’s longest reversible cable car, this 9th-century monastery offers breathtaking views.

Activities
-
Hiking and Trekking: Armenia’s rugged landscapes offer excellent hiking trails for all skill levels.
-
Skiing: Tsaghkadzor is a popular ski resort with modern facilities.
-
Wine Tasting: Armenia is one of the oldest wine-producing countries in the world.
-
Festivals: Experience traditional events like the Yerevan Wine Days and the Dolma Festival.
Cost To Visit Armenia
A one-week trip to Armenia can cost around ₹70,000-₹90,000 per person, including flights, accommodation, food, and sightseeing. Budget travelers can manage with ₹50,000-₹60,000.

1. Do Indians need a visa for Armenia?
Yes, Indian citizens require a visa to enter Armenia for tourism, business, or other purposes. You can apply for an Armenia e-Visa online.
2. Is there a visa on arrival for Indians in Armenia?
No, there is no visa-on-arrival facility for Indian nationals in Armenia. You must obtain an Armenian visa before your trip.
3. Is an Armenian visa easy to get for Indians?
Yes, getting an Armenian visa is relatively easy for Indians. The e-visa process is simple and quick, and it takes just three business days to process.
4. What are the Armenia visa fees for Indian visitors?
The Armenia tourist visa fees for Indians range from USD 6 for a visitor visa to USD 30 for a long-term visa.
5. What is the eligibility for an Armenia visa for Indians?
Indian citizens who have a valid passport, a completed visa application, passport-sized photos, proof of accommodation, financial proof, and a return ticket are eligible for an Armenia visa.

8.Are children eligible to apply for an Armenia visa?
Yes, children are eligible to apply for an Armenia visa. They must have a valid passport, a completed visa application form, a recent passport-sized photograph, a birth certificate, and a no-objection certificate (NOC) from parents or guardians if traveling alone or with one parent.
